What is Unlearning?

Unlearning is how we become conduits for possibility.

Unlearning is a spiral and a living practice, not a linear path. We reveal patterns, honor what they gave, grieve what they cost, explore something different, return to what's true, and reweave something new.

Then we do it again and again, each time discovering new depths to ourselves and each other.

What We Do

The Unlearning Studio is a way of being together: a sanctuary for unwinding and exploring that lives wherever we meet.…

We offer an ecosystem of support for transformation.

Deep coaching for navigating inflection points. Creative gatherings for accessible practice, play, and community. Immersive journeys for full-body unlearning through travel and intensive experience. You know what you need. We trust you to find your way to what's right for you.

We gather virtually and in person.

What binds our experiences together isn't the format; it's the feeling. The way we tend to presence, relationship, and rhythm and the commitment we hold to gather in ways that nourish, not extract.

We draw inspiration from ancestral technologies of connection and creativity.

Think embroidery circles, quilting bees, and bread-braiding traditions that have always woven making with meaning. When we stir, stitch, mend, dye, weave, knead, and chat, we invite conversations that begin with presence rather than words. Rather than talking about creating, we create while we connect.
